The MOT Class 7 Testing Process

Pre-Test Inspection

Before commencing the official test, our certified technicians conduct a thorough pre-test inspection of the commercial vehicle. This inspection aims to identify any visible defects or issues that may affect the outcome of the test.

Comprehensive Examination

During the MOT Class 7 test, our technicians meticulously examine various components of the commercial vehicle, including:

  • Braking System: Assessing the performance and condition of the brakes to ensure they meet safety standards.
  • Suspension and Steering: Checking for wear and damage in the suspension and steering components.
  • Exhaust Emissions: Testing the vehicle's emissions to ensure compliance with environmental regulations.
  • Lights and Signals: Verifying the functionality of all lighting and signaling systems, including headlights, indicators, and brake lights.
  • Tyres and Wheels: Inspecting tyre condition, tread depth, and pressure, as well as wheel alignment.
